Herve, you've uncovered a bloody global perl context switch bug. Please try this patch (the reproducing tar ball now works for me under worker)

This test does run successfully with your patch.
Now define two directives.
Use one inside the Location, another outside, and core dumps again.
Test tarball attached.

Thanks Herve. Please try this patch on top of the one I've sent before.

Works so far for me with your new patch.

Now I have a new problem with the patched version: no way to get the value of the configuration directive at the server level.
New test tarball attached.

Attachment: bug-report.tgz
Description: Binary data

Reply via email to